A shock-absorbing non-slip sole, comprising a midsole 1, a front outsole 2 and a rear outsole 3, the midsole 1 includes a front palm part 11, a shoe waist part 12, a rear palm part 13, and a front palm part 11 arranged in sequence from front to back.
